Early Times Report JAMMU, Nov 14: Alexander Memorial School, Jammu celebrated Children's Day and birth Anniversary of Pt. Jawahar Lal Nehru with a series of engaging events designed to honour the students and celebrate the spirit of childhood. The festivities kicked off with a special prayer and speech by Principal, Mrs. Marshlaw Khokhar, of Alexander Memorial School, Jammu highlighted the importance of the day by remembering the legacy of Pandit Jawahar Lal Nehru, who championed the cause of children and education. The celebration served as a reminder of the school commitment to nurturing the students' talent, knowledge and over well being. Teachers filled the atmosphere with beautiful dance performances solo songs, Puzzles and poetry. The programme ended with National Anthem and the students were given sweets. |
